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Chocolate Twist Pastries

Step 1: Preheat and Prepare
Begin by preheating your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per to prevent sticking and ensure easy cleanup. While the oven heats, have your ingredients ready, especially the fully thawed puff pastry. This ensures that your Chocolate Twist Pastries will be quick and simple to assemble.

Step 2: Roll Out the Puff Pastry
Once your oven is preheated, roll out each sheet of puff pastry on a lightly floured surface into two rectangles, measuring approximately 10×18 inches. Make sure the pastry is even; this is key for achieving those flaky layers that are the hallmark of these delicious Chocolate Twist Pastries.

Step 3: Spread the Nutella
Spread a generous layer of Nutella evenly over one of the pastry sheets, taking care to leave a ½-inch border all around. This will keep the filling from spilling out as they bake. Then, sprinkle mini chocolate chips over the Nutella, providing an extra bite of chocolatey goodness in each twist.

Step 4: Assemble the Pastries
Carefully place the second pastry sheet on top of the first, gently pressing down to adhere the layers together. This creates a delightful sandwich that will puff beautifully in the oven. Make sure the edges align for a neat finish that looks as good as it tastes when baked.

Step 5: Cut and Twist
Using a sharp knife or pizza cutter, slice the layered pastry into 8 equal strips along the short side. Once cut, take each strip and twist it 2-3 times to create that beautiful spiral shape we all love in Chocolate Twist Pastries. This step also creates those lovely flaky layers.

Step 6: Arrange on Baking Sheet
Carefully arrange the twisted pastries on your pr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art. This allows them room to expand while baking and achieves that golden-brown finish. Be sure to position them so they have adequate space for puffing up.

Step 7: Brush with Egg Wash
In a small bowl, whisk an egg until smooth, then brush the egg wash generously over each pastry twist. This will give them a beautiful glaze as they bake. If you’re feeling fancy, sprinkle turbinado sugar on top for added crunch and sparkle, enhancing the overall presentation of your Chocolate Twist Pastries.

Step 8: Bake to Perfection
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ake the pastries for about 14-16 minutes or until they are golden brown and puffed up. Keep a close eye on them during the last few minutes to prevent over-baking, as oven temperatures can vary.

Step 9: Cool and Dust
Once baked, remove the pastries from the oven and allow them to cool on a wire rack for a few minutes. This cooling step helps them set perfectly. Before serving, dust the Chocolate Twist Pastries with powdered sugar for an elegant finishing touch that makes them utterly irresistible.

Make Ahead Options

Chocolate Twist Pastries are a fantastic choice for meal prep, saving you time on busy days! You can prepare the pastries up to 24 hours in advance by assembling them up to the point of baking. Simply complete the steps of rolling out the puff pastry, spreading the Nutella and chocolate chips, and twisting the strips, then place them on a baking sheet. Cover tightly with plastic wrap and refrigerate. When you’re ready to serve, preheat your oven and remove them from the fridge. Brush with egg wash, sprinkle with turbinado sugar, and bake as directed for that fresh-out-of-the-oven taste. This way, you’ll have delicious Chocolate Twist Pastries, hot and flaky, with minimal effort!

Expert Tips for Chocolate Twist Pastries

  • Thawing Puff Pastry: Ensure your puff pastry is completely thawed before use; incomplete thawing can cause tearing and affect the flaky texture.

  • Even Nutella Spread: Use an offset spatula for spreading Nutella evenly to avoid excess filling seeping out during baking, which can lead to messy pastries.

  • Egg Wash Alternatives: If you want a vegan option, simply brush the pastries with a plant-based milk instead of egg wash for a beautiful finish without compromising the recipe.

  • Keep an Eye on Baking: Monitor the pastries closely as they bake; the final minutes are crucial to prevent over-browning and ensure your Chocolate Twist Pastries stay perfectly golden.

How to Store and Freeze Chocolate Twist Pastries

Room Temperature: Store leftover pastries in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 4 days to maintain their delightful texture and flavor.

Freezer: For longer storage, wrap each pastry tightly in plastic wrap and place them in a freezer-safe bag. They can be frozen for up to 3 months, preserving their delicious taste.

Reheating: To enjoy your frozen Chocolate Twist Pastries, thaw them in the fridge overnight and then reheat in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 10-15 minutes until warm and flaky.

Tip for Freshness: Avoid microwaving, as it can make them soggy—oven reheating ensures that lovely crispy exterior remains intact!

Ingredients
  

For the Pastries
  • 1 sheet Puff Pastry store-bought
  • 1/2 cup Nutella or almond butter for a twist
  • 1/2 cup Mini Chocolate Chips chop larger chips for better spreading
For the Topping
  • 2 tablespoons Turbinado Sugar for sprinkling on top
  • 1 cup Powdered Sugar for dusting before serving

Equipment

  • Oven
  • Baking Sheet
  • Parchment Paper
  • Whisk
  • knife or pizza cutter
  • Offset Spatula

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ions for Chocolate Twist Pastries
  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Roll out each sheet of puff pastry on a lightly floured surface into two rectangles, approximately 10x18 inches.
  3. Spread a generous layer of Nutella evenly over one of the pastry sheets, leaving a ½-inch border around.
  4. Sprinkle mini chocolate chips over the Nutella.
  5. Carefully place the second pastry sheet on top of the first and press down gently.
  6. Slice the layered pastry into 8 equal strips along the short side and twist each strip 2-3 times.
  7. Arrange the twisted pastries on your pr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
  8. Brush egg wash over each pastry twist and sprinkle turbinado sugar on top if desired.
  9. Bake for about 14-16 minutes until golden brown and puffed up.
  10. Cool on a wire rack for a few minutes and dust with powdered sugar before serving.
